Canonical Tags: How to Solve Duplicate Content Issues Permanently
Struggling with Duplicate Content? Master Canonical Tags the Right Way
Duplicate content is one of the most common technical SEO problems affecting websites today. Even well-optimized websites can struggle with indexing issues, ranking dilution, and crawl inefficiencies when multiple versions of the same content exist across different URLs. This is where canonical tags become essential.
A canonical tag tells search engines which version of a page should be treated as the primary version. Instead of forcing Google and other search engines to guess which URL deserves rankings, canonicalization provides a direct signal that consolidates authority, relevance, and indexing behavior.
If you regularly explore technical SEO guides and optimization strategies, understanding canonical tags is critical for maintaining long-term search visibility.
What Is a Canonical Tag?
A canonical tag is an HTML element placed inside the <head> section of a webpage. It uses the rel="canonical" attribute to indicate the preferred version of a page.
For example, the following URLs may display identical or very similar content:
- https://example.com/page
- https://www.example.com/page
- https://example.com/page?ref=twitter
- https://example.com/page/
Without canonicalization, search engines may treat these URLs as separate pages. This divides ranking signals and creates duplicate content confusion.
By adding a canonical tag, all SEO value can be consolidated into one preferred URL.
Why Duplicate Content Hurts SEO
Duplicate content does not usually trigger penalties, but it creates several serious SEO problems:
1. Ranking Signal Dilution
Backlinks, engagement metrics, and authority may become split across multiple versions of the same page.
2. Crawl Budget Waste
Search engines spend valuable crawl resources indexing duplicate URLs instead of discovering important pages.
3. Indexing Confusion
Google may choose the wrong version of a page for search results.
4. Unstable Rankings
Different duplicate versions may compete against each other, causing keyword instability.
This is why proper canonical management is considered a foundational part of modern SEO workflows and technical optimization.
Common Causes of Duplicate Content
URL Parameters
Tracking parameters such as UTM tags can create multiple URL versions of the same page.
WWW vs Non-WWW Versions
If both versions remain accessible, search engines may index both separately.
You can test this using the WWW vs Non-WWW Canonical Test.
Pagination Issues
Blog archives, product categories, and paginated listings can accidentally create conflicting canonical signals.
The Canonical Pagination Conflict Checker helps identify these problems quickly.
Cross-Domain Duplicate Content
Content syndication and mirrored websites often create duplication across multiple domains.
The Multi-Domain Canonical Checker can help audit these situations efficiently.
Best Practices for Canonical Tags
Use Self-Referencing Canonicals
Every important indexable page should include a canonical tag pointing to itself. This helps reinforce the preferred URL structure.
Use Absolute URLs
Always use complete URLs instead of relative paths inside canonical tags.
Avoid Canonical Chains
Do not point one canonical URL to another canonical URL repeatedly. Keep canonical targets direct and clean.
Match Canonicals with Internal Linking
Your internal links should support your canonical structure consistently.
Combine Canonicals with Redirects
Redirects and canonical tags work best together. Redirects handle user navigation while canonicals guide indexing signals.
How to Check Canonical Errors
Canonical problems often remain hidden until rankings drop or indexing becomes unstable. Regular audits are important.
The Canonical Link Checker allows you to inspect canonical implementation on individual pages.
For deeper analysis, the Canonical Conflict Checker identifies conflicting SEO signals that may confuse search engines.
Website owners managing multiple technical SEO tasks can also explore the SEOlust platform, which includes a growing collection of free SEO and optimization tools.
Canonical Tags vs Redirects
Canonical Tags
Canonical tags suggest the preferred version to search engines while still allowing alternate URLs to exist.
301 Redirects
Redirects permanently move users and search engines to another URL.
If duplicate pages no longer serve a purpose, redirects are usually the better solution. If duplicate URLs must remain accessible, canonical tags are often preferred.
How Canonicalization Helps Large Websites
Ecommerce stores, news websites, and enterprise platforms often generate thousands of duplicate URLs through filtering, sorting, pagination, and tracking parameters.
Proper canonical implementation improves crawl efficiency, preserves ranking signals, and simplifies indexing behavior at scale.
Many SEO professionals combine canonical auditing with automation and analysis tools from SEOlust Calculators and utility tools to streamline technical optimization workflows and productivity.
Final Thoughts
Canonical tags remain one of the most powerful yet misunderstood technical SEO elements. When implemented correctly, they help search engines understand your preferred URLs, eliminate duplicate content confusion, and consolidate ranking authority across your website.
Whether you run a personal blog, ecommerce platform, or enterprise website, canonicalization should be part of every long-term SEO strategy.
By regularly auditing your pages using SEOlust canonical tools and maintaining a clean URL structure, you can solve duplicate content issues permanently and build a stronger technical SEO foundation for future growth.